Sugar Cookie Cake

Sugar Cookie Cake Recipe

Indulge in the delightful sweetness of this Sugar Cookie Cake Recipe, perfect for spring celebrations or any festive occasion. This vibrant cake is a fun fusion of classic sugar cookies and colorful M&Ms, topped with festive sprinkles. Easy to make and customize, it’s a hit with both kids and adults alike.

Ingredients

  • ¾ cup unsalted butter (softened)
  • ¾ cup granulated s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½ teaspoon baking soda
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on cream of tartar
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up spring-colored M&Ms
  • ½ cup Easter sprinkles
  • 3 tablespoons unsalted butter (softened) for frosting
  • 1 ½ cups powdered s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ract for frosting
  • ⅛ teaspoon salt for frosting
  • 2 tablespoons heavy whipping cream or milk for frosting

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a 9-inch round cake pan with foil and spray it with nonstick cooking spray.
  2. In a mixing bowl, beat softened butter and granulated sugar until creamy. Add the egg and vanilla extract; mix until combined.
  3. Gradually add baking soda, salt, and cream of tartar; mix well. Slowly incorporate flour until fully blended. Gently stir in M&Ms and sprinkles.
  4. Press the batter into the prepared pan (adding more M&Ms on top if desired) and bake for 19-22 minutes until edges are light golden brown. Let it cool completely before frosting.
  5. For the frosting, beat softened butter until smooth, gradually adding powdered sugar, salt, vanilla extract, and heavy cream until spreadable.
  6. Frost the cooled cookie cake and decorate with additional sprinkles and M&Ms.
